Output 31a5f2b165b522d56481ac1ea9a1f08efd5cbcc104fccd87ac1fddeaec8b2306:22

value
483908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cf188b7971673b03a89c1c02770665ffebfbf10 OP_EQUAL
address
3D5f4QnGPvwqnUoD6fY4W4xqPw8LLyTTu9
transaction
31a5f2b165b522d56481ac1ea9a1f08efd5cbcc104fccd87ac1fddeaec8b2306
spent
true